Ghana highlights disability inclusion progress at UN Conference in New York

Ghana has reaffirmed its commitment to advancing the rights and welfare of persons with disabilities at the 19th Session of the Conference of States Parties (COSP19) to the Convention on the Rights of Persons with Disabilities (CRPD), held at the United Nations Headquarters in New York from June 9 to 11, 2026.
